Roomful Of Blues

Effective period / Period of releases: 1977 - 2008

Members: Lou Ann Barton, Ronnie Earl, Greg Piccolo, John Rossi, Al Copley, Preston Hubbard, Duke Robillard, Doug James (3), Porky Cohen, Bob Enos, Sugar Ray Norcia, Rich Lataille, John Turner (9), Carl Gerhard, Ronnie Horvath, Ephraim Lowell, Chris Vachon, Ken "Doc" Grace, Chris Anzalone, Phil Pemberton, Dave Howard (16), Rusty Scott (4), Alek Razdan

Roomful of Blues is an American blues and swing revival big band formed in Providence, Rhode Island, USA, in 1967.
With a recording career that spans over 50 years, they have toured worldwide and recorded many albums. Until 1979 the band was fronted by Duke Robillard.
